由于传统网络多信道时延控制方法主要在模拟信道频域上获得信道模拟参数,导致多信道时间同步误差较大,为此提出基于离散数学模型的网络多信道时延一致性控制方法.首先,建立网络模拟信道的时域离散数学模型,以便获取信道的传输时延.其次,结合时延的时变性特点,对网络多信道时延进行一致性控制.最后,进行仿真实验.实验结果表明,设计方法的总时延与参考信道时延的差值最小,优于对照组.
Multi-channel Delay Consistency Control Method of Network Based on Discrete Mathematical Model
Due to the fact that traditional network multi-channel delay control methods mainly obtain channel simulation parameters in the frequency domain of simulated channels,resulting in significant synchronization errors in multi-channel time,a network multi-channel delay consistency control method based on discrete mathematical models is proposed.Firstly,establish a time-domain discrete mathematical model of the network simulation channel to obtain the transmission delay of the channel.Secondly,combining the time-varying characteristics of delay,consistency control is implemented for multi-channel delay in the network.Finally,conduct simulation experiments.The experimental results show that the difference between the total delay of the design method and the reference channel delay is the smallest,which is better than the control group.
